There are 3 types of jurisdiction in UAE: Free zone, Offshore and Mainland. For any investor to operate their business in the local market require either Free Zone or Mainland company. Both jurisdictions have their own pros and cons depending on the business activity. Whilst Mainland Company registered with DED is permitted to carry on business anywhere in the world including the United Arab Emirates (UAE), Free Zone business entity operation is restricted in respective Free Zone. But looks like things are changing slowly.
Earlier, as per law, a Dubai free zone registered company had only one option to expand its business in mainland i.e. either by restructuring through incorporating a branch or subsidiary company or through mediators.
Now, there is a new development under the law. An initiative has been taken by Department of Economic Development (DED) according to which, all Free Zone companies that are operating inside Dubai can now apply for a permit to DED for doing the business transaction in mainland without opening a branch. This permit is issued only to companies registered in Dubai Free Zones. However, it must be noted that the permit is available to selected activities only.
